Re: [PATCH v2 2/2] platform/chrome: cros_ec_lpcs: reserve the MEC LPC I/O ports first

From: Prashant Malani
Date: Thu Jan 27 2022 - 13:55:24 EST


Hi Dustin,

On Jan 26 12:00, Dustin L. Howett wrote:
> Some ChromeOS EC devices (such as the Framework Laptop) only map I/O
> ports 0x800-0x807. Making the larger reservation required by the non-MEC
> LPC (the 0xFF ports for the memory map, and the 0xFF ports for the
> parameter region) is non-viable on these devices.
>
> Since we probe the MEC EC first, we can get away with a smaller
> reservation that covers the MEC EC ports. If we fall back to classic
> LPC, we can grow the reservation to cover the memory map and the
> parameter region.
>
> This patch also fixes an issue where we would interact with I/O ports
> 0x800-0x807 without first making a reservation.

I can't find this update in the EC code base [1]. Is there any reason
you are not adding this, or is the change in flight (or in some other
location)?
